Versatility for all: an art exhibit by Aaron S. Bivins

Aaron S. Bivins works primarily in acrylic, oil and watercolor and explores other media. His subjects range from landscapes, seascapes, florals, portraits, animals and homes. “By not becoming comfortable with where I am and taking chances when I paint, I will continue to grow,” says Bivins. He intends for viewers to “see” the portrayal with new eyes by using values, color and light.

His love for art began many years ago as a young child. Throughout his career, he has won numerous awards including several Best of Show and First Placements. His work has been exhibited in community and commercial gallery exhibits throughout the Northwest Ohio region, some of which were solo exhibitions. Aaron holds a B.A. in Art from The University of Toledo in Ohio. A former junior high school art teacher in the Toledo Public School system, Bivins now serves a painting demonstrator and conducts watercolor and acrylic workshops and classes.  Mr. Bivins is an Associate member of the Ohio Watercolor Society and Past-President of the Northwestern Ohio Watercolor Society. He is also a member of the Toledo Artists Club.
